🔥 Quick Facts
Final score: Rockets 129, Jazz 101 on November 30, 2025
Kevin Durant: returned from a two-game absence and scored 25 points
Sources: Game recaps from ESPN and NBA.com
Streak: Houston recorded its fifth straight road victory
Jazz vs Rockets recap: Houston sets tone early
The Rockets seized momentum early and never looked back. Houston controlled the paint and tempo from tipoff.
Kevin Durant paced the offense with efficient scoring and spacing. Durant finished with 25 points in his return.
The Jazz struggled to find consistent perimeter production. Utah could not close the scoring gaps late.
